Practical PHP 7, MySQL 8, and MariaDB Website Databases: A Simplified Approach to Developing Database-Driven Websites
暫譯: 實用的 PHP 7、MySQL 8 與 MariaDB 網站資料庫:簡化的資料庫驅動網站開發方法
Adrian W. West
買這商品的人也買了...
-
$480$379 -
$650$553 -
$690$587 -
$1,050$1,029
商品描述
Build interactive, database-driven websites with PHP 7, MySQL 8, and MariaDB. The focus of this book is on getting you up and running as quickly as possible with real-world applications. In the first two chapters, you will set up your development and testing environment, and then build your first PHP and MariaDB or MySQL database-driven website. You will then increase its sophistication, security, and functionality throughout the course of the book.
The PHP required is taught in context within each project so you can quickly learn how PHP integrates with MariaDB and MySQL to create powerful database-driven websites.
Each project is fully illustrated, so you will see clearly what you are building as you create your own database-driven website. You will build a form for registering users, and then build an interface so that an administrator can view and administer the user database. You will create a message board for users and a method for emailing them. You will also learn the best practices for ensuring that your website databases are secure. Later chapters describe how to create a product catalog, and a simple e-commerce site. You will also discover how to migrate a database to a remote host. The final chapter will demonstrate the advantages of migrating to Oracle's MySQL 8. You will be shown step by step migration directions along with a demonstration of the tools available in SQL Workbench.
Because you are building the interactive pages yourself, you will know exactly how MySQL, MariaDB, and PHP all work together, and you will be able to add database interactivity to your own websites with ease.
What You Will Learn
- Build a secure database-driven website using PHP 7, MySQL 8, and MariaDB
- Create a product catalog
- Write a message board
- Move towards e-commerce
- Employ security and validation measures
- Migrate to Oracle's MySQL 8 Server platform
Who This Book Is For
Web developers with HTML, CSS and a limited Bootstrap experience. Readers need little to no prior experience with PHP and MySQL.
商品描述(中文翻譯)
建立互動式、以資料庫驅動的網站,使用 PHP 7、MySQL 8 和 MariaDB。本書的重點是讓您能夠快速上手,並實作真實世界的應用程式。在前兩章中,您將設置開發和測試環境,然後建立您的第一個 PHP 和 MariaDB 或 MySQL 資料庫驅動網站。接下來,您將在本書的過程中逐步提升其複雜性、安全性和功能性。
所需的 PHP 知識將在每個專案中進行教學,讓您能夠快速學習 PHP 如何與 MariaDB 和 MySQL 整合,以創建強大的資料庫驅動網站。
每個專案都有完整的插圖,您將清楚地看到在創建自己的資料庫驅動網站時所構建的內容。您將建立一個用戶註冊表單,然後建立一個介面,讓管理員可以查看和管理用戶資料庫。您將創建一個用戶留言板以及一種發送電子郵件的方法。您還將學習確保網站資料庫安全的最佳實踐。後面的章節將描述如何創建產品目錄和一個簡單的電子商務網站。您還將發現如何將資料庫遷移到遠端主機。最後一章將展示遷移到 Oracle 的 MySQL 8 的優勢。您將逐步獲得遷移指導,並演示 SQL Workbench 中可用的工具。
因為您自己建立互動頁面,所以您將確切了解 MySQL、MariaDB 和 PHP 如何協同工作,並能輕鬆地將資料庫互動性添加到自己的網站中。
您將學到的內容:
- 使用 PHP 7、MySQL 8 和 MariaDB 建立安全的資料庫驅動網站
- 創建產品目錄
- 編寫留言板
- 朝向電子商務發展
- 採用安全性和驗證措施
- 遷移到 Oracle 的 MySQL 8 伺服器平台
本書適合對象:
具備 HTML、CSS 和有限 Bootstrap 經驗的網頁開發者。讀者幾乎不需要具備 PHP 和 MySQL 的先前經驗。